| Click factor name to view rationale | Intolerance | Recoverability | Sensitivity | Species Richness | Evidence /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Substratum Loss | High | Moderate | Moderate | Major decline | Moderate |
| Smothering | Tolerant | Not relevant | Not sensitive |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Increase in suspended sediment | Intermediate | High | Low | Minor decline | Low |
| Decrease in suspended sediment | Tolerant* | Not relevant | Not sensitive* | No change | Low |
| Desiccation | Intermediate | High | Low | Decline | Moderate |
| Increase in emergence regime | Intermediate | High | Low | Major decline | Low |
| Decrease in emergence regime | Tolerant | Not relevant | Not sensitive |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Increase in water flow rate |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Decrease in water flow rate | Intermediate | High | Low | Decline | Moderate |
| Increase in temperature | Low | Very high | Very low | Minor decline | Low |
| Decrease in temperature | Low | Very high | Very low | Minor decline | Low |
| Increase in turbidity | Tolerant | Not relevant | Not sensitive |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Decrease in turbidity | Tolerant* | Not relevant | Not sensitive* | No change | Not relevant |
| Increase in wave exposure | High | Moderate | Moderate | Major decline | Moderate |
| Decrease in wave exposure |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Noise | Tolerant | Not relevant | Not sensitive |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Visual Presence | Tolerant | Not relevant | Not sensitive |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Abrasion & physical disturbance | Intermediate | High | Low | Decline | Moderate |
| Displacement | High | Moderate | Moderate | Major decline | Moderate |
| Click factor name to view rationale | Intolerance | Recoverability | Sensitivity | Species Richness | Evidence /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Synthetic compound contamination | Intermediate | High | Low | Minor decline | Low |
| Heavy metal contamination | Low | Very high | Very low | No change | Low |
| Hydrocarbon contamination | Low | High | Low | Minor decline | Low |
| Radionuclide contamination | Insufficient information | Insufficient information | Insufficient information | Insufficient Information | Not relevant |
| Changes in nutrient levels | Low | Very high | Very low | No change | Low |
| Increase in salinity |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Decrease in salinity | Low | Very high | Very low | Minor decline | Low |
| Changes in oxygenation | Low | Very high | Very low | Minor decline | Low |
| Click factor name to view rationale | Intolerance | Recoverability | Sensitivity | Species Richness | Evidence / Confidence |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Introduction of microbial pathogens/parasites | Insufficient information | Insufficient information | Insufficient information |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Introduction of non-native species |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ant |
| Extraction of this species | High | Moderate | Moderate | Major decline | Low |
| Extraction of other species |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ant | Not relevant |
